Man, 39, Lands In Trouble For Allegedly Engaging Girl,14, In Sex

Posted on September 19, 2025
KINGSLEY EBERE 
 
A 39-year old man, Joseph Alao Ojo, has landed in trouble in Lagos State for allegedly luring and engaging a 14-year old girl in sex romp. 
P.M.EXPRESS reports that the suspect,  Ojo, has been arrested and charged for the alleged defilement under the Criminal law of the State.
The incident happened on 24th day of July, 2025, at Aina Akinbola Street, Omole Phase II, Lagos.
According to the Police, the suspect lured the victim into his apartment and seduced her before he engaged her in sexual intercourse by penetration. And having satisfied himself, he allowed her to go and warned her not to tell anyone about it.
However, the information leaked and the victim’s parents asked her what happened. She then revealed how the suspect lured and engaged her in the act without her consent.
The matter was reported to the Police in the area. The suspect was arrested and transferred to the Gender Section of the Lagos State Police Command for interrogation over his alleged conduct.
While being interrogated at the Gender Section, the suspect reportedly admitted to have done so with the consent of the victim. But that could not save him because of the age of the victim.
The Police found him culpable and charged him before the Ogba Magistrate Court for the alleged offence which attracts several years of imprisonment.
The charge read:
“That you, Joseph Alao Ojo ‘m’, on the 24th day of July, 2025, at Aina Akinbola Street, Omole Phase II, Lagos, in the Lagos Magisterial District, did defile one girl ‘f 14years old by having sexual intercourse with her and thereby committed an offence punishable under Section 137 of the Criminal Law of Lagos State of Nigeria, 2015.”
However,  the Court did not take his plea following a motion moved by the prosecutor,  Inspector Lucky Ihiehie, asking the Court to give a date and refer the matter to the DPP for legal advice.
The Presiding Magistrate, Mrs. M.O.Tanimola, ordered his remand in custody at the correctional center at Kirikiri town, Lagos, pending the outcome of the DPP’s advice and directed the prosecutor to duplicate the file and send it to the DPP for legal advice.
The matter was adjourned for mention for the report of the DPP’s advice to be available, which will determine if the matter will be transferred to the High Court or not over jurisdiction.
